Guidelines to success of the track doubling project (Jira-Khon Kaen railway junction) by method of construction a railway underpass using Box Jacking

Abstract

Method of constructing a railway underpass using the Box Jacking method. It is the main factor affecting the success of the Jira-Khon Kaen double track railway construction project which has been completed as intended. It is the first project in Thailand to develop a railway underpass construction technique using the Box Jacking method. which trains can pass at a speed of 20 kilometers per hour while pushing through under a railway,  then no need to wait for a new track for bypass a trains. This saves time / reduces costs and is beneficial for laying 80-pound railroad tracks faster than the traditional plan that uses the method of open-cut the embankment. The construction management for 76 Box Jacking and work/calculating the jacking force used for pushing the box underpasses.  In the soil layer of the northeastern region (Loess Soil). For designing/calculating and building drill heads, size 2.7 m x 2.8 m., 3 machines, size 3.7 m x 8.65 m., 2 machines, and size 4.35 m x 8.9 m., 2 machines. Including changing the fixing support of 8 Number of 100-ton double-acting hydraulic cylinders. Which is taken from a Kawasaki tunnel boring machine (Earth pressure balance) of the Blue Line Extension Project (Contract 2) that has the end attached to the concrete floor (Thrust Bed) in an off-center manner, is a type that pushes axially against the concrete wall (Thrust Wall). Makes it possible to control the direction of movement of the box underpass both vertically and horizontally according to the requirements. By creating a hydraulic system that can be controlled remotely with a wireless remote control.
